YooF is the truly amazing and dynamic Youth Group of Avendale and Drumclog Church  in Strathaven, (Scotland).  There are about forty of us  from S1 to Uni - making us one of the biggest and most active groups around - but we're a close knit and friendly bunch who spend loads of time together - eating - doing amazing things - eating a bit more - making music -  having fun. Our Praise band has produced two CDs and we even made a feature length Movie - 'Collinder and the Missing Body' and had 200 at the World Premiere!  

But best of all we have fun sharing our faith and growing as Christians.  That's really what YooF is about.  The 24/7 prayer week - the praise group - alpha - the mix - are all at the heart of what we do. Some of us are the organising team behind Powerprayze - the largest Christian Youth event in Lanarkshire.   Strathaven is pretty much in the heart of central Scotland and we have a heart for God.

 Thought for this week - courtesy of Your YooF leadership team....                          Being of Use to God

"In a well-furnished kitchen there are not only crystal goblets and silver platters, but waste cans and compost buckets—some containers used to serve fine meals, others to take out the garbage. Become the kind of container God can use to present any and every kind of gift to his guests for their blessing."  2 Timothy 2 (20-21) The Message

This week we looked at 'being useful to God' and thought about this young man Timothy who was charged with looking after a church in Lystra.  It was a great challenge and Paul wanted to encourage him.

We focussed on the fact that - God does not have to use us - he can get by pretty neatly without us. But when he does use us it blesses us, strengthens our faith, builds us up. But the reading above is about preparing ourselves and making sure that we can be useful.  Are we available for God (or do we fill our time up with lots of things that mean we're not available).  Is our lifestyle good and pleasing in God's sight?  (You wouldn't trust a cheat with a secret - would you?) 

So the question is - are you making yourself available, clean and ready to be used by God - for whatever he wants you to do.  It's a challenge.  Read the rest of 2 Timothy this week and make a note of all the challenges to your life there are in it.
